The biggest hunger relief organization in the U.S. is using technology to help restaurants, grocery stores, and other businesses fight food waste.
In honor of Earth Day on Saturday, Feeding America launched a new tech platform called MealConnect. As its name implies, the free service taps into the organization's large network, connecting businesses that have surplus food with thousands of food banks and other meal programs.
The goal is to advance the organization's mission of solving hunger in the country by 2025 by tackling the persistent yet often overlooked problem of food waste caused by businesses and food chains. Read more...
